Post subject: | MTV Movie Awards Nominations |
...why not. They're less horrible than usual this year. Movie of the Year THE AVENGERS THE DARK KNIGHT RISES DJANGO UNCHAINED SILVER LININGS PLAYBOOK TED Best Female Performance Anne Hathaway, LES MISERABLES Mila Kunis, TED Jennifer Lawrence, SILVER LININGS PLAYBOOK Emma Watson, THE PERKS OF BEING A WALLFLOWER Rebel Wilson, PITCH PERFECT Best Male Performance Ben Affleck, ARGO Bradley Cooper, SILVER LININGS PLAYBOOK Daniel Day-Lewis, LINCOLN Jamie Foxx, DJANGO UNCHAINED Channing Tatum, MAGIC MIKE Breakthrough Performance Ezra Miller, THE PERKS OF BEING A WALLFLOWER Eddie Redmayne, LES MISERABLES Suraj Sharma, LIFE OF PI Quvenzhané Wallis, BEASTS OF THE SOUTHERN WILD Rebel Wilson, PITCH PERFECT Best Scared as Shit Performance (lol) Jessica Chastain, ZERO DARK THIRTY Alexandra Daddario, TEXAS CHAINSAW 3D Martin Freeman, THE HOBBIT: AN UNEXPECTED JOURNEY Jennifer Lawrence, HOUSE AT THE END OF THE STREET Suraj Sharma, LIFE OF PI Best On-Screen Duo Robert Downey Jr. and Mark Ruffalo, THE AVENGERS Will Ferrell and Zach Galifianakis, THE CAMPAIGN Leonardo DiCaprio and Samuel L. Jackson, DJANGO UNCHAINED Bradley Cooper and Jennifer Lawrence, SILVER LININGS PLAYBOOK Mark Wahlberg and Seth MacFarlane as Ted, TED Best Shirtless Performance (lol x2) Christian Bale, THE DARK KNIGHT RISES Daniel Craig, SKYFALL Taylor Lautner, THE TWILIGHT SAGA: BREAKING DAWN PART 2 Seth MacFarlane as Ted, TED Channing Tatum, MAGIC MIKE Best Fight Robert Downey Jr., Chris Evans, Mark Ruffalo, Chris Hemsworth, Scarlett Johansson and Jeremy Renner vs. Tom Hiddleston, THE AVENGERS Christian Bale vs. Tom Hardy, THE DARK KNIGHT RISES Jamie Foxx vs. Candieland Henchmen, DJANGO UNCHAINED Daniel Craig vs. Ola Rapace, SKYFALL Mark Wahlberg vs. Seth MacFarlane as Ted, TED Best Kiss Kerry Washington and Jamie Foxx, DJANGO UNCHAINED Kara Hayward and Jared Gilman, MOONRISE KINGDOM Emma Watson and Logan Lerman, THE PERKS OF BEING A WALLFLOWER Jennifer Lawrence and Bradley Cooper, SILVER LININGS PLAYBOOK Mila Kunis and Mark Wahlberg, TED Best WTF Moment Javier Bardem - "Oops...There Goes His Face," SKYFALL Anna Camp - "Hack-Appella," PITCH PERFECT Jamie Foxx and Samuel L. Jackson - "Candieland Gets Smoked," DJANGO UNCHAINED Seth MacFarlane as Ted - "Ted Gets Saucy," TED Denzel Washington - "Final Descent," FLIGHT Best Villain Javier Bardem, SKYFALL Marion Cotillard, THE DARK KNIGHT RISES Leonardo DiCaprio, DJANGO UNCHAINED Tom Hardy, THE DARK KNIGHT RISES Tom Hiddleston, THE AVENGERS Best Musical Moment Anne Hathaway, LES MISERABLES Channing Tatum, Matt Bomer, Joe Manganiello, Kevin Nash and Adam Rodriguez, MAGIC MIKE Anna Kendrick, Rebel Wilson, Anna Camp, Brittany Snow, Alexis Knapp, Ester Dean and Hana Mae Lee, PITCH PERFECT Bradley Cooper and Jennifer Lawrence, SILVER LININGS PLAYBOOK Emma Watson, Logan Lerman and Ezra Miller, THE PERKS OF BEING A WALLFLOWER http://www.deadline.com/2013/03/mtv-mov ... ve-stream/ |
